[PDF] Trier – Divide and conquer Tri fusion d'une liste –





Previous PDF Next PDF



Tri par sélection

selection(Tj) ; fpour ;} :; GA



1 Tri par sélection

Implémentons cette méthode de tri sous Python : Nous allons utiliser deux fonctions : • une fonction fusion qui prend en entrée deux tableaux T1 et T2 



Chapitre 1 : Les algorithmes de tris par insertion et par sélection I

(La partie de gauche est donc amenée à évoluer avec les insertions successives). Tri par insertion en Python def tri_par_insertion(T):. """trie le tableau T 



I. Tri par sélection

On trie récursivement les deux parties avec l'algorithme du tri fusion. • On fusionne les deux tableaux triés en un tableau trié. 2 - code Python a) Fusion de 



CAPES MATHS OPTION INFORMATIQUE ALGORITHMIQUES DE TRI

Ecrire en Python une version récursive de l'algorithme du tri par fusion d'un tableau de réels. def fusion(gauche droite): igauche



Les algorithmes de tris et leurs implémentations en Python

tri par fusion sur vecteur par rapport au tri par segmentation et au tri par tas (présentés plus loin). La fonction tri_entre trie les composantes du sous ...



Informatique en CPGE (2018-2019) Algorithmes de tri 1 Introduction

Programme du tri par fusion : def tri_fusion(liste): if len(liste)<2: return L'algorithme de tri utilisé en Python est appelé timsort inventé par Tim Peters ...



TD7 – Algorithmes de Tri

Le tri préprogrammé en Python est nommé « Timsort ». Il s'agit d'un tri. « hybride » faisant intervenir tri fusion et tri par insertion. Vous trouverez des 



ALGORITHMIQUE & CALCUL NUMÉRIQUE

On considère deux méthodes de tri : le tri par sélection (ou tri par 2-7 Le programme Python. → Tri par sélection. # Tri par sélection. # Données initiales.



Algorithmes classiques

1) Tri par sélection: Ce tri est parfois appelé naïf. Le principe Exercice 7 : Écrire un programme Python permettant de réaliser un tri à bulle shaker.



1 Tri par sélection

C'est le tri du joueur de cartes. Il consiste à insérer successivement chaque élément T[i] dans la portion du tableau T[0 :i] déjà triée. (En Python.



G. Aldon - J. Germoni - J.-M. Mény Mars 2012

Le principe du tri par sélection d'une liste T = (T[1]T[2]



Leçon 903 : Exemples dalgorithmes de tri. Correction et complexité

On commence par étudier les tris naïfs : ceux qui ne mettent en place aucun paradigme de programmation ni structures de données élaborées. Tri par sélection. — 



CAPES MATHS OPTION INFORMATIQUE ALGORITHMIQUES DE TRI

Ecrire en Python la procédure de tri par sélection par ordre croissant



Algorithmes de tri

la complexité (ici : nombre de comparaisons) du tri par sélection est en O(n2). ... Travaux pratiques. Programmes en Python. . . (Pourquoi Python ?)



Trier – Divide and conquer

Tri fusion d'une liste – Programme Python. Python def trifusion(T) : if len(T)<=1 : return T. T1=[T[x] for x in range(len(T)//2)].



Informatique en CPGE (2018-2019) Algorithmes de tri 1 Introduction

Le tri par insertion d'un tableau à n éléments [t0



1 Algorithmes de tri

Appliquer l'algorithme de tri par sélection à la main pour trier les listes d'entiers Programmer en Python une fonction tri_insertion pour compléter le ...



jean-manuel Mény– IREM DE LYON () Algorithmique 2013 1 / 39

18 mars 2013 algorithmes de tris suivants et savoir les programmer : tri par sélection tri par fusion. jean-manuel Mény– IREM DE LYON (). Algorithmique.



Les algorithmes de tris et leurs implémentations en Python

Sur vecteur le tri par insertion est un peu plus délicat à programmer que le tri par extraction car on a besoin d'effectuer une permutation circulaire vers la 



Trier par sélection - Maxicours

Tri s election { programme python Python def selection(Tdebut) : indiceDuMin=debut for k in range(debut+1len(T)) : if T[k]

Comment faire un tri par sélection enpython ?

Coder en Python l’algorithme de tri par sélection d’un tableau de nombres. Le tri par sélection d’un tableau consiste rechercher le plus petit élément et à le placer en 0, le second plus petit élément et à le placer en 1, etc. Le cout d’un tri par sélection est toujours quadratique. Utiliser des boucles ( for et while ).

Comment utiliser l’algorithme de tri par sélection ?

Dans l’algorithme de tri par sélection, nous cherchons l’élément le plus petit et on le met au bon endroit. Nous échangeons l’élément en cours avec le prochain élément le plus petit. Le tri par sélection fonctionne mieux avec un petit nombre d’éléments.

Comment faire un tri par sélection ?

Le tri par sélection d’un tableau consiste rechercher le plus petit élément et à le placer en 0, le second plus petit élément et à le placer en 1, etc. Le cout d’un tri par sélection est toujours quadratique. Utiliser des boucles ( for et while ). Algorithmes de recherche : rechercher un extremum (terminaison, correction et cout). 1.

Comment trier les éléments d’un tableau à l’aide du tri par sélection ?

N ous pouvons créer un programme Python pour trier les éléments d’un tableau à l’aide du tri par sélection. Dans l’algorithme de tri par sélection, nous cherchons l’élément le plus petit et on le met au bon endroit. Nous échangeons l’élément en cours avec le prochain élément le plus petit.

[PDF] tri par selection python wikipedia

[PDF] tri par selection recursive python

[PDF] tri rapide python

[PDF] triacylglycerol

[PDF] triad complementary colors examples

[PDF] triangle 2d shape

[PDF] triangle congruence calculator

[PDF] triangle geometry

[PDF] triangle notes pdf

[PDF] triangle theorems pdf

[PDF] triangular prism faces

[PDF] triangular prism volume

[PDF] triangular prism volume and surface area

[PDF] triangular prism volume calculator

[PDF] triangular prism volume example